Netserver5/133

I just got a old Netserver 5/133 looks to be in good condition but i have played with it a little and i can not get it to boot got it to post and it says EISA CONF BAD RUN Configeration uitillity witch i guess is ECU? floppy wont boot how di i get it to? and are there any .doc on this computer on the HP site please help thanks Joe

Re: Netserver5/133

I am assuming this is an LC server. Here is a link to the system board info. I would move switch 3 to the on position and boot it, then power the system down and move the switch back and then try and boot to the ECU. Remeber the BIOS level and ECU must match, so if the BIOS level is older than the ECU, try flashing the BIOS first. HEre is the link:
